AMZN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2015 in Review

1,101 of the 3,753 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Amazon (AMZN) for Q1 2015, worth a combined $116B — up 23% from $93.9B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 159 funds opened new AMZN positions and 85 closed out — a net gain of 74 holders — while 388 added to existing stakes and 410 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Wellington Management Group, adding an estimated $927M. The largest seller was T. Rowe Price Associates, cutting an estimated $393M.
